The Heroic Space Marines

Space Marines are the iconic warriors of the Warhammer 40K universe. They are genetically-enhanced super soldiers created to protect the Imperium of Man. These noble warriors possess several defining traits that set them apart from other factions. Firstly, their unwavering loyalty to the Emperor and their dedication to duty make them the ultimate defenders of humanity. Their unyielding resolve in the face of overwhelming odds is a testament to their unwavering commitment.

Secondly, Space Marines are renowned for their physical prowess and combat skills. Enhanced strength, speed, and endurance allow them to excel in battle, becoming formidable adversaries on the battlefield. Their mastery of various weapons and combat techniques makes them versatile warriors capable of adapting to any situation. Additionally, their intricate power armor provides them with advanced protection and augmented senses, further enhancing their effectiveness in combat.

Chapter Specializations and Tactics

Each Space Marine Chapter specializes in a particular aspect of warfare, showcasing different traits and tactics. For example, the Ultramarines are known for their strategic brilliance and adherence to the Codex Astartes. They are disciplined and organized, utilizing combined arms tactics to achieve victory. On the other hand, the Space Wolves embrace their feral nature, drawing strength from their savage instincts and the power of their unique psychic abilities. These traits shape the playstyle and strategies of each Chapter, ensuring diversity within the Space Marine faction.

The Cunning Orks

In stark contrast to the disciplined Space Marines, the Orks embody chaos and anarchy. These brutish creatures revel in violence and thrive on the thrill of battle. Their defining traits include an insatiable bloodlust, a propensity for destruction, and a remarkable ability to reproduce at an alarming rate. These traits make the Orks a force to be reckoned with on the battlefield.

Orks are known for their primal intelligence and their ability to create haphazard weaponry and machinery. Their anarchic nature gives them an advantage in battle, as their lack of structure allows for unpredictable tactics. The sheer ferocity and numbers of the Orks often overwhelm their enemies, with their Waaagh! energy fueling their aggression and making them even deadlier.

Ork Clans and Playstyles

The Ork faction is further diversified by the presence of various clans, each with its own defining traits and playstyles. The Goffs, for example, are known for their brutal melee combat, while the Bad Moons excel in ranged warfare. These clan traits dictate the preferred tactics and strategies of Ork players, adding depth and versatility to their gameplay.
